Garrett Community College Information Technology Associate’s Degrees

For the most recent IPEDS reporting year, Garrett College awarded 7 associate’s degrees in information technology.

Associate’s Student Diversity

Among recent graduates, 71% of information technology associate’s degrees went to men and 29% went to women.

Garrett Community College gender breakdown of Information Technology Associate's degree grads The largest share of information technology associate’s degree graduates at Garrett Community College are White. About 86% of graduates fell into this category.

Computer and Information Systems Security/Auditing/Information Assurance (Associate’s)

Garrett Community College conferred 7 associate’s degrees in computer and information systems security/auditing/information assurance recently — 29% to women and 71% to men. Most of these graduates identified as White (86%).
